[高等教育]第三部分 Linux内核分析与移植.pptVIP

  • 3
  • 0
  • 约8.67千字
  • 约 71页
  • 2018-03-05 发布于浙江
  • 举报

[高等教育]第三部分 Linux内核分析与移植.ppt

[高等教育]第三部分 Linux内核分析与移植

嵌入式Linux系统开发 2010/03 课程介绍 主要内容 -嵌入式Linux介绍 -Linux内核 -设备驱动程序基础 -文件系统 -开发工具和调试技术 -GUI -... 我的联系方式 EMAIL:zhijie.ni@ QQ:807064747 入门要求 精通C语言 了解和熟悉汇编语言(GNU汇编) 熟悉ARM或其他处理器 具备一定的硬件知识 熟悉操作系统原理 熟练使用一种GNU/Linux发行版(推荐Ubuntu) 良好的英语阅读能力 学习目标 嵌入式Linux开发环境的建立 掌握基于S3C2410开发板的BootLoader(U-Boot)移植、内核移植、驱动开发 根文件系统的制作和部署 各种开发、调试工具的使用 回顾 嵌入式系统简介 为什么使用Linux 处理器基础 交叉开发环境 引导装入程序 嵌入式系统简介 具备处理器 针对某类应用或目的 简单的人机接口 资源受限 功耗限制 软件内置 软硬件集成发布 通常独立工作,无需人工干预 为什么使用Linux 开源、免费 成熟、高性能、稳定 支持新型硬件平台、架构 支持大量的应用和网络协议 适应性强(小型设备-大型的交换机、路由器) 大量的开发者,资源丰富(文档、补丁等) 大量软硬件厂商的支持 处理器基础 CISC和RISC架构 单机处理器 集成

文档评论(0)

1亿VIP精品文档

相关文档